Rudolf Stingel (1956 - ) is a conceptional painter and installation artist who was born in Italy and resides in America. In 2007 when he was holding respective exhibitions in New York and Chicago, he installed silver reflect light acoustic panels on the wall as an installation work on which audiences can engrave freely. Later on, he selected some of them to make copper plates and gilded them with gold so as to be a series of sculptures. One of the series was completed in 2012 and entitled “Untitled”, which was sold for 15.68 Million Hong Kong dollars on October 3rd, 2016. The material of this piece is galvanized cast copper, nickel and gold, and the size is 120 x 100.3 CM.
